[cvsnt] Audit failure when using 3055 client against 2260 server

Bo Berglund bo.berglund at telia.com
Wed May 28 06:42:10 BST 2008


I have updated my CVSNT client to 2.5.04.3055 (see other thread as to
why) and then I had to do some maintenance of code against a server
running 2.5.03.2260.
The strange thing is that all commands now fail as shown in the two
examples below:

cvs log -- modules
audit_trigger error (session): [Microsoft][ODBC SQL Server Driver][SQL
Server]String or binary data would be truncated.[Microsoft][ODBC SQL
Server Driver][SQL Server]The statement has been terminated.
Audit trigger initialiasation failed: 
cvs server: Pre-command check failed
***** CVS exited normally with code 1 *****

and

cvs ver
***** CVS exited normally with code 1 *****
Client: Concurrent Versions System (CVSNT) 2.5.04 (Zen) Build 3055
(Release Candidate 7) (client/server)
Server: audit_trigger error (session): [Microsoft][ODBC SQL Server
Driver][SQL Server]String or binary data would be
truncated.[Microsoft][ODBC SQL Server Driver][SQL Server]The statement
has been terminated.
Audit trigger initialiasation failed: 
cvs server: Pre-command check failed

Notice that I have *only* changed the *client* side version (I cannot
touch the production server).

So I had to disable 3055 and revert back to 2382 on my side and then
all was back to normal.

Why is a client version change affecting the way the audit system is
handled on the server?????
Sounds crazy to me.

HTH

/Bo
(Bo Berglund, developer in Sweden)


More information about the cvsnt mailing list